A leading technology firm based in Farnborough, UK, is seeking a Network Engineer to design and deliver secure digital solutions. The role involves collaborating with engineers to create technology that supports Defence and National Security missions.
Candidates should have experience with Wide Area Networks, VPNs, and security infrastructure.
Benefits include:
- Competitive salary
- 25 days annual leave
- Private medical cover
- And more
Security Clearance eligibility is required for this position.

How to prepare for a job interview at Sixworks
✨Know Your Tech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Wide Area Networks, VPNs, and security infrastructure. Be ready to discuss specific technologies you've worked with and how they relate to the role. This will show that you're not just familiar with the concepts but can apply them in real-world scenarios.
✨Showcase Your Collaboration Skills
Since the role involves working closely with other engineers, be prepared to share examples of past collaborations. Talk about how you’ve contributed to team projects, resolved conflicts, or shared knowledge. This will demonstrate your ability to work effectively in a team environment.
✨Understand the Mission
Familiarise yourself with Defence and National Security missions relevant to the company. Showing that you understand the bigger picture and how your role contributes to these missions can set you apart from other candidates. It shows you’re not just looking for a job, but are genuinely interested in the impact of your work.
✨Prepare for Security Clearance Questions
Since eligibility for Security Clearance is required, be ready to discuss your background and any potential issues that could affect your clearance. Be honest and upfront about your history, as transparency is key in these discussions. This will help build trust with your interviewers.
